settings ui: Create settings key trait (#37489)
This PR separates out the associated constant `KEY` from the `Settings` trait into a new trait `SettingsKey`. This allows for the key trait to be derived using attributes to specify the path so that the new `SettingsUi` derive macro can use the same attributes to determine top level settings paths thereby removing the need to duplicate the path in both `Settings::KEY` and `#[settings_ui(path = "...")]` Co-authored-by: Ben Kunkle <ben@zed.dev> Release Notes: - N/A --------- Co-authored-by: Ben Kunkle <ben@zed.dev>
